Who are the Main Characters in Will and Grace?
The "Will and Grace" cast consists of several prominent actors who have become synonymous with their roles. The main characters are:
- Will Truman - A gay lawyer played by Eric McCormack
- Grace Adler - A straight interior designer portrayed by Debra Messing
- Jack McFarland - Will's flamboyant best friend, played by Sean Hayes
- Karen Walker - Grace's wealthy and eccentric best friend, depicted by Megan Mullally

What Impact Did the Will and Grace Cast Have on LGBTQ Representation?
The "Will and Grace" cast played a pivotal role in shaping the representation of LGBTQ characters on television. Will, as a gay man, and his friendships with Grace, Jack, and Karen, shattered stereotypes and brought visibility to the gay community in a way that was both humorous and heartfelt. The show tackled important issues like relationships, acceptance, and the complexities of identity, often using comedy as a means to address serious topics.
